The property at 238 Seeley Street is located in the McCreery neighborhood of North La Junta, an unincorporated pocket of Otero County, located immediately adjacent to the north/northwestern border of La Junta, Colorado. This setting offers a distinct semi-rural environment characterized by larger residential lots, mature open views of the Arkansas River Valley basin, and an absence of dense commercial congestion.
Transportation and commuting throughout the Arkansas Valley region are straightforward. The neighborhood provides immediate access to major arterial routes, including US Highway 50 and State Highway 109, allowing residents to travel to downtown La Junta's business district in under five minutes. For regional commuters, Rocky Ford is approximately 15 minutes to the west, while Las Animas lies roughly 20 minutes east.
Outdoor recreation and cultural landmarks surround the local district. Just a short drive away lies Bent's Old Fort National Historic Site, offering walking trails and immersive living history exhibits along the historic Santa Fe Trail. In addition, the Arkansas River corridor and nearby John Martin Reservoir State Park offer premier regional opportunities for boating, fishing, bird watching, and nature photography.
Civic and daily amenities are concentrated in central La Junta, providing access to grocery stores, regional healthcare at Arkansas Valley Regional Medical Center, local diners, and public services. Higher education and workforce training opportunities are anchored locally by Otero College, which serves as a regional cultural and educational hub with athletic facilities and community programming.
